Chapter Eight

THURSDAY NIGHT BAKING class started off in the usual fashion, with Amos lecturing the class about the importance of baking temperatures and how just a few degrees could spell disaster for certain recipes, but then it took an unexpected turn.

“Tonight we’re going to do something a little different. I’ve printed out some new recipes for this evening, and that means everyone will be baking something different,” Amos said as he handed out the printouts to everyone. Amos winked at Russ when he handed him his recipe and went back to the front of the classroom. “I’ll be helping Russ tonight again since his partner is home with her newborn. I will still be walking through to check on your progress, and of course, if you need me, feel free to holler.” Amos donned an apron and joined Russ at his station.

Russ recognized his recipe right away – it was the pecan tassies that he and Amos hadn’t made the evening he’d been at Russ’s house. “So we’re making one of David’s recipes?” he asked as he put the butter and cream cheese into the stand mixer.

“I’m trying to help you make the things you wanted to bake.”

“Why?”

“Because I feel bad about misjudging you, okay? This is my way of making it up to you.” Amos took out a big bowl and a whisk so he could mix together the filling that consisted of melted butter, an egg, brown sugar, vanilla, and salt.

“But I feel bad that all these people are getting shunted to the side while I’m basically getting a private lesson,” Russ said.

“Everyone is baking something, and that’s what this class is about. I made sure to give them each a recipe that played to their strengths, so they shouldn’t need much supervision.”

Russ wasn’t going to argue with Amos about how he ran his class. Instead, he concentrated on not fucking up the dough for the tassies. The class went quickly because Russ had lots of busy work to do, pressing little dough balls into a mini muffin tin before spooning a tiny amount of filling into them and then topping them off with a pecan. He made sure to set the timer after putting the first pan in and returning to make the second pan. By the end of the class, he had four dozen perfect pecan tassies, and Amos had only mixed the filling so Russ was feeling pretty proud of himself when he packed up his goodies in the container to take them home.

Since there had been no flub-ups, just one slightly overdone pan of cookies, Amos hadn’t taken the class to the front to point out any mistakes. Russ was the only one remaining since Amos had deserted him, leaving him to do his own cleanup while he said his goodbyes to the class. Just as the last student left, Russ put his coat on and picked up his containers. He had argued with himself over asking Amos out, but after Amos had admitted that he felt bad for him, he’d decided to can that plan.
